**Facilities Ticket — Basement Archive, Marrowgate Annex**

Heads up: the swipe reader on the B1 archive room door is playing up again — cards get rejected about half the time. An engineer is booked for Thursday. Until then, team assistants needing the archive should skip the reader and use the backup keypad instead. The temporary keypad code is below.

door code, kawip-bagap: bdg-HQEWH-4

Ticket #A-2291 — Vault locked during cold storage archival

The Nordfell archival vault locked itself after three failed unseal attempts during last night's bucket migration. Affected buckets remain in a pending state and cannot be re-queued until the vault is reopened. On-call: please unseal carefully, verify the audit trail first, and confirm bucket integrity afterward. Unseal using the recovery passphrase below.

vault phrase of bagaf-kajeg = jorath-feniel-briir-siliel-ralix

# Gridmere Admin — Environments

Bulk edits in the admin table are gated per environment. Staging allows up to 500 rows per batch; prod caps at 100 and requires a dry-run pass first. Failed batches roll back atomically. If bulk edit jams, check the queue depth before killing workers. Prod currently runs with these settings.

deployment values, fafog-fawip:
[jorox]
team = fendor
access_code = ac_bb00ea
host = jorox.qorveltech.internal
port = 9200
owner = istdor.aldeth
peer = julvan.orvexlabs.internal

14:22 — The Bramleton lint service began rejecting all plugin-submitted SQL files, including previously passing ones. Investigation showed rule set v9 had shipped with a stricter quoting check that treated bracketed identifiers as errors, which affected every third-party plugin targeting the Oakmere dialect. Plugin authors should note that no action on their side caused this; the regression was entirely in our rule compiler. We reverted to v8 at 14:41 and captured the failing build's trace token for reference, reproduced below.

session token of tajef-bageg = htk21_5d90d574934f3ccae6437